Additional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Devendra Kumar Sharma, who had summoned Gupta for today, fixed the case for hearing on May 5 in pursuance to a Delhi High Court order.
Gupta's counsel submitted that his client has challenged the court's order of taking cognisance on the IT department's complaint filed against him and the high court has reserved its verdict on the petition.
The IT department, in its compliant against Gupta, has alleged that he had not filed the income tax return of USD 1.5 million for financial year 2005-2006 and when questioned and confronted by the department about it, he admitted it.
It alleged that he had later filed the income tax return and declared the amount in his income.
The department said that on being asked by it, Gupta had refused to give his bank account details, after which the complaint was filed against him under section 276 D (failure to produce accounts and documents) of the IT Act.
According to the department, the HSBC Bank account was opened by Gupta in 2006 and it was closed in 2007 and tax was deposited by him voluntarily in 2011.
